
Artificial radioactivity was discovered by:
A. Rontgen
B. Becquerel
C. Marie Curie
D. Irene Joliot Curie

Hint: Radioactivity is a natural process in which an unstable nucleus loses energy in the form of radiation to form a new nucleus, buy artificial radio-activity is the man-made radioactivity where radiation is used to induce radioactivity in a previously stable material.
Complete step by step answer:
-Rontgen - Rontgen was a physicist who detected and invented some rays of electromagnetic radiation which falls in certain wavelengths which are called . Since he was involved in x-ray discovery, he did not discover artificial radio-activity. Hence, it is not the correct answer.
-Becquerel - Becquerel is the derived unit of radioactivity in the SI unit system. It is named after French Scientist Antoine Henri Becquerel after he studied , and observed that uranium is a radioactive element. Since, it is not related to artificial radioactivity, so, it is a wrong answer.
-Marie Curie - Marie Curie was a chemist and physicist who studied radiation and discovered the elements Polonium, and Radium. She was not involved in the discovery of artificial radioactivity. Hence, Marie Curie is not the correct answer.
-Irene Joliot Curie - She was the daughter of Marie Curie, and she was awarded the Nobel prize for discovering artificial radioactivity. She discovered that alpha-particle bombardment of aluminium elements produces an intermediate unstable isotope which is phosphorus.
Hence, option (d) is the correct answer. Irene Joliot Curie discovered artificial radio-activity.
Note: Artificial radioactivity, also called induced radioactivity, makes a radioactive isotope by capturing neutrons. Addition of neutrons to a nuclide results in an increase in the number of isotopes by , while keeping the same atomic number.
